This grammar quiz focuses on two essential English language concepts: past tense verb forms and relative pronouns. The content is appropriate for 8th grade students who are developing mastery of complex grammatical structures. The first fourteen questions systematically assess students' understanding of simple past versus past continuous tenses, requiring them to distinguish between completed actions and ongoing actions in the past, as well as navigate the correct subject-verb agreement patterns. The final six questions evaluate students' command of relative pronouns (who, whose, which, that), testing their ability to identify the appropriate pronoun based on whether it refers to people, objects, or indicates possession. Students need solid foundational knowledge of verb conjugation patterns, an understanding of how time relationships work in narrative contexts, and the ability to analyze grammatical relationships between clauses.
